One of the most useful skills you can learn in order to progress your skills on a mountain bike is proper braking. Braking properly on the trail equates to safer and faster speeds while you’re riding. Because of this, having proper brakes to stop you on the drop of a dime is crucial when it comes to riding technical, fast trails. We put together a list of just 5 of the most powerful MTB brakes currently on the market for those of you out there looking to upgrade from a simple 2-piston brake to something with quite a bit more stopping power. Next to a helmet for your head, knee protection is one of the most important pieces of protective gear that you should get for riding a mountain bike. Having proper protection to shield your legs from injury on the trail is key to spending as much time on your bike as you can, one swift fall and you can end up in a world of hurt that keeps you off the bike longer than you’d like. Additionally, you should be in something that is not only protective, but comfortable as well, which is where knee sleeves come into play. Although they might not be as protective as a hard shell knee pad, knee sleeves provide plenty of protection while still being comfortable so you can pedal around all day safely. We decided to round up some of our favorite knee sleeves to show you some key differences and what you might want to look for when purchasing a pair. Not all mountain bikes are created equal! In this video, we break down the four main types of mountain bikes—Cross Country (XC), Trail, Enduro, and Downhill—and explain what makes each one unique. Whether you're into climbing, descending, technical trails, or pure speed, there's a perfect MTB style for your riding goals.
